Beaulieu firm shortlisted for top industry awards after bringing history to life across the world

Beaulieu-based audio visual company, DJ Willrich Ltd (DJW), hopes to add to its growing trophy cabinet as it has been shortlisted for two top industry awards.

DJW has been honoured for its work on two projects out of the three shortlisted – in the ‘consumer installation of the year’ category of the AV Awards 2012- Titanic Belfast and Fort Edmonton Park in Canada.

Managing Director, David Willrich, said: “It is a huge honour to be shortlisted not once but twice in the AV Awards 2012. We are incredibly proud of these two projects and to have our work recognised by our industry peers is a fantastic feeling.”

DJW designed, supplied, installed and programmed the AV and show control systems for the Capitol Theatre show experience at Fort Edmonton Park, Canada’s largest living history park. Through its clever use of AV, DJW was able to create a 3D effect without having to wear glasses, using two screens; create the illusion of a cinema screen being cracked by ice and trigger snow falling on the visitors.

Its work at the recently-opened Titanic Belfast project has received international acclaim and DJW’s innovative interactive features have helped to bring the story of the Titanic to life for visitors from across the world.

DJW will discover if it has won its category at a glittering awards ceremony in London this October.
